Both the federal government … Web16 Dec 2024 · In the United States, the government of each state follows the same three-branch format as the federal government. This means that state governments have executive, legislative and judicial branches. Each state must operate within the boundaries of its constitution. State Executive Government A state government is the government that controls a subdivision of a country in a federal form of government, which shares political power with the federal or national government. A state government may have some level of political autonomy, or be subject to the direct control of the federal government. This relationship may be defined by a constitution.
